Mikel resumes Chelsea duty Monday

NIGERIAN international John Obi Mikel barring any hitch will resume on Monday at Chelsea according to his manager and agent Olatunji John Shittu.
Shittu, claimed that the management of the English Premier League side gave Mikel and other players who played beyond the early rounds of the just-ended Brazil 2014, till Monday to report
for pre-season training.
The other players who are directed to resume on Monday are Thibaut Courtois of Belgium, Kenneth Omeruo, Eden Hazard of Belgium, Victor Moses, Ramires of Brazil, Andre Schurrle of Germany, Willian of Brazil, and Romelu Lukaku of Belgium.
When Chelsea began it pre-season training a few days ago without Mikel and other listed players, the media was awash with news that Mikel's future with the London side is uncertain, as arrangements had been concluded to ease him out by manager, Jose Mourinho.
But Shittu described the report as inaccurate,
“I don’t know where the story emanated from, but I can tell you authoritatively that it is false. Mikel and other Chelsea players who played beyond the first round of the World Cup will resume club duty on July 28.
"He came home briefly to see his family after the World Cup, he returned to London last week to collect visas for the countries where Chelsea will play pre-season, so the report is not true, he still a Chelsea player," he said.
Shittu also described as untrue reports that Chelsea wants to sell Mikel for £5million.
“Mikel has a subsisting contract with Chelsea and he intends to respect that contract, I also know that Chelsea is not planning to sell him; he is part of Jose Mourinho’s plan," Shittu maintained.
